General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.151(c): Where employees were exposed to injurious corrosive materials, suitable facilities for quick drenching or flushing of the eyes and body were not provided within the work area for immediate emergency use: An adequate eyewash station was not provided in the immediate area for emergency use for employees who charged and serviced the forklift batteries.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.303(b)(2): Listed or labeled electrical equipment was not used or installed in accordance with instructions included in the listing or labeling: In the IT room, a relocatable power tap was connected in series (daisy chained) to a second relocatable power tap to power the Lantech wrapper, m/n Q300, s/n QM016764 (115 VAC).

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.305(a)(1)(i): Metal raceways, cable armor, and other metal enclosures for conductors were not connected to all boxes, fittings, and cabinets to provide effective electrical continuity: The metal conduit for the trash compactor was not metallically connected to the junction box to provide effective electrical continuity.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.305(g)(1)(iv)(B): Flexible cords and/or cables were run through holes in walls, ceilings, or floors: Located along the south wall, the Lantech wrapper, s/n QM016764, was powered by a relocatable power tap that had the flexible cord run trough a hole in the wall.
